    Packers Have Reportedly Contacted Pro Bowl QB

    By Max Escarpio,

    4 hours ago

    The Green Bay Packers are searching for a new signal caller following an injury to Jordan Love.

    The franchise quarterback is believed to have injured his MCL in the Packers' recent 34-29 loss to the Philadelphia Eagles in Week 1. According to ESPN, Love is pending further testing, but he is expected to miss some time at the start of the season.

    Given the Packers' need for a new quarterback, they have reportedly contacted Pro Bowl QB Ryan Tannehill. Green Bay reached out to Tannehill, but there is no deal in place, per Dianna Russini, an NFL insider for The Athletic.

    Green Bay currently has Malik Willis, who was traded from the Titans in the offseason, backing up Love at quarterback.

    Tannehill is 36 years old. He was a backup to Will Levis in Tennessee last season but is no longer rostered. After beginning his career with the Miami Dolphins, he spent five seasons with the Titans.

    The veteran quarterback would be able to bring experience, having played in the league from 2012-23.

    In his last season as a full-time starter, 2022, Tannehill produced 13 touchdowns and 2,536 yards with a 65.2 completion percentage.

    As Russini reported, Tannehill and his party mentioned that the situation would have to be right for him to come back to the NFL.

    The Packers are a team that came into the year with Super Bowl hopes, having a solid football team on all three levels of the game.

    Tannehill would be able to play behind an experienced offensive line, with a couple of promising young receivers in Jayden Reed and Christian Watson.
